Biography
Agustina Marin, born on January 6, 2003, in Buenos Aires, Argentina, is a prominent Argentine basketball player recognized for her exceptional skills on the court. She began her basketball journey at a young age, showcasing her talents in local youth leagues before advancing to club-level competition. Her remarkable performance in national tournaments soon caught the attention of scouts, leading to her inclusion in Argentina's national youth teams.
Marin's career highlights include her significant contributions to the Argentine national team during the FIBA U18 Women’s Americas Championship, where she played a crucial role in the team's successful campaign. Her athleticism and versatility as a guard earned her accolades, and she was named to the tournament's All-Star team. In addition to her international achievements, Marin has excelled in domestic leagues, further establishing her reputation as one of Argentina's rising basketball stars.
